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/angularjs/25.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 如果选中,则将复选框中的值存储到字符串中_Javascript_Angularjs - Fatal编程技术网

Javascript 如果选中,则将复选框中的值存储到字符串中

Javascript 如果选中,则将复选框中的值存储到字符串中,javascript,angularjs,Javascript,Angularjs,我想将复选框中的值存储到字符串中 <label style="color:black; text-decoration:none; font-size:15px" href="#"> <input type="checkbox" ng-model="diet.v1" ng-true-value="'&diet=high-fiber'" ng-false-value="''" />High-Fiber</label>

我想将复选框中的值存储到字符串中

 <label style="color:black; text-decoration:none; font-size:15px" href="#">
                  <input type="checkbox" ng-model="diet.v1" ng-true-value="'&diet=high-fiber'" ng-false-value="''" />High-Fiber</label> 

高纤维
如何从
ng true value
(选中时)获取字符串的值,以便使用它?
当我尝试类似于console.log(diet.v1)的东西时;在js中,它不会工作

请检查以下工作示例代码是否有ng true值,ng false值


示例-示例复选框输入指令生产
angular.module('checkboxExample',[])
.controller('ExampleController',['$scope',function$scope){
$scope.diet={
v1:“”
};
}]);
价值:

value={{diet.v1}}

当我单击checkboxvalue1时,它会在我需要的内容和空字符串之间更改.value1的值,仅供参考。checkboxModel.value2基于您的要求。我知道,但当我输入自己的costum值并尝试单击复选框时,该值在ng true值和ng false值之间会发生变化。出于某些原因,请检查plunker,我使用了与您的代码相同的代码:还添加了代码段,请检查。您也可以在plunker中发布代码以供进一步检查。